Hi all

Recently scrapped off my old td4 freelander 1 and replaced it with a range rover evoque 2013 2.2 td4 and I'm wanting to fit a tow bar are the electrics plug and play like the old freelander rear will it need to be programmed only wanting the electrics for the lights
 
It'll depend on how sensitive the new tow bar kit and vehicle electrics are.
Some kits will just accept the connections to the existing light wires on the car.
More and more modern vehicles need to be programmed to change brake performance and cooling patterns which are sensitive to load, also to automatically cancel reverse sensors when a trailer or caravan is attached..
